DESCRIPTION:Miami\, Florida\nUnited States\n  \nABOUT THE MIAMI FILM FESTIVAL\nMiami Film Festival is a world-class platform for International\, American\, and Ibero-American films. The Festival showcases the work of the world’s best emerging and established filmmakers to the diverse cosmopolitan community of Miami. Cash awards totaling more than $100\,000 are given in competition categories. \nIn recent years\, the Miami Film Festival has attracted approximately 45\,000 people a year\, as well as 300 filmmakers\, producers\, talent and industry professionals from around the world as it showcases more than 100 feature narratives\, documentaries and short films of all genres\, from 40 different countries. Highlights of recent festivals have included award presentations and exclusive in-depth conversations with film legends Pedro Almodovar\, Penelope Cruz\, Rita Moreno\, Riz Ahmed\, Ramin Bahrani\, Ryusuke Hamaguchi\, Aldis Hodge\, Javier Camara\, Andra Day\, Ari Wegner\, Cristobal Tapia de Veer\, and Joshua James Richards; and numerous World and International Premieres. \nThe Festival also hosts dozens of world-class events every year\, including the Mercado de Cine Frances y Europeo\, which brings together over 40 buyers and sellers from Europe and Latin America; annual events in partnership with VARIETY\, including The International Feature Film Award Roundtable; as well as numerous workshops\, masterclasses\, legendary parties\, and industry happy hours. \nHistorically\, the Festival has had the privilege of hosting a noted group of filmmakers and talent\, including Barry Jenkins\, Isabelle Huppert\, Carlos Saura\, Richard Gere\, Rashida Jones\, Sarah Jessica Parker\, Lena Olin\, Pablo Larrain\, Edward James Olmos\, Monica Bellucci\, Rossy de Palma\, Gloria and Emilio Estefan\, Spike Lee\, Andy Garcia\, Patricia Clarkson\, Stella Meghie\, Joe Talbot\, Jason Reitman\, Lulu Wang and countless more. Simultaneously\, it strives to be a beacon of support to local filmmaking talent and has elevated the work of numerous local filmmakers via exciting marquee screenings and generous cash awards like the Knight Made in MIA prize for locally-produced features and shorts. \nMajor trade publications such as Variety\, The Hollywood Reporter\, Screen and Indiewire attend for coverage and reviews of the films. DESCRIPTION:Telluride\, Colorado\nUnited States\n  \nABOUT THE TELLURIDE FILM FESTIVAL\nEach Labor Day weekend\, the tiny mountain village of Telluride\, Colorado triples in size for the Telluride Film Festival. Swells of passionate film enthusiasts flood the town for four days of total cinematic immersion\, embarking on a viewing odyssey\, blissfully spending entire days in flickering dark rooms. With only an appreciation of celluloid to guide them\, these devotees flock to the show\, year after year. Why? Blind faith. We don’t reveal the program until everyone lands in town. Yet the Telluride family trusts that a unique experience will unfold. \nThe Telluride Film Festival is not just a picture show. It is Tributes to luminaries who've propelled the medium forward; it is candid discussions with a film’s creator or the historian who champions it; it is discovering that the person in line behind you made the film you just enjoyed; it is engaging in lively debate with every manner of film lover in the summer sun of a Colorado afternoon\, always minutes away from a new exhibition. Our audiences were the first in the world to laugh with JUNO\, to observe THE LIVES OF OTHERS\, to visit BROKEBACK MOUNTAIN\, to learn the secret of THE CRYING GAME\, to experience BLUE VELVET\, and to witness THE CIVIL WAR. We resurrected the silent epic NAPOLEON\, and highlighted the genius of animator Chuck Jones. \nWe take great pains to remain not a competition\, but a celebration of the best in film — past\, present and future — from all around the world. This is one weekend immersed in an unabashed carnival of film: viewing\, breathing\, eating\, and talking cinema. This is The SHOW. \n  \nGENERAL INFORMATION\nDeadline: Feature\, Student and Short films must be submitted no earlier than April 15th \, and no later than July 1st\, 2025. Early or late entries will not be accepted. \nSubmit as early as possible! Once the submission period is open\, submitting as early as possible not only allows more time for consideration\, but you will also not run the risk of missing the deadline. No late submissions will be considered at all. \nFinish line: All submissions (for all catagories) must have been completed after last year's submission deadline of July 1st\, 2024 . We will only accept works-in-progress with picture lock. Please note that we do NOT accept updated versions. \nScreening Status: With very rare exceptions\, feature length films (60 minutes or longer) will only be considered if they are to have their first North American screenings at TFF. Any domestic public exposure prior to our Labor Day event may preclude the work from eligibility. (This applies mainly to features\, we’re not so sticky about short films. However\, we do not accept shorts that have been released online prior to the Festival.) \nSubmission Method: All films must be submitted via a secure URL link and made accessible through August 1st\, 2024.  All films submitted must be downloadable.  The Telluride Film Festival is committed to the privacy and creative property of all filmmakers\, and downloads will be shared internally for programming consideration purposes only. If there are changes to the accessibility of your link\, you must contact the Festival ASAP via email: submissions@telluridefilmfestival.org \nPresentation Format: If your film is accepted for exhibition\, Telluride Film Festival accepts 35mm and DCP for screenings. \nFestival Notification: Final program determinations will be made by August 1st. You will be notified in writing by the first week of August whether your film has been invited to screen with us or not. Except in emergencies\, please do not call the Festival office for disposition. \nImportant reminder for all Filmmaker's submissions: If your film is accepted\, invitations may be sent as late as the first week of August. DESCRIPTION:Santa Barbara\, California\nUnited States\n  \nABOUT THE SANTA BARBARA INTERNATIONAL FILM FESTIVAL\nThe Santa Barbara International Film Festival (SBIFF) is a 501(c)(3) non-profit arts and educational organization. Over the past 35 years\, SBIFF has become one of the leading film festivals in the United States – attracting 100\,000 attendees and offering 11 days of 200+ films\, tributes and panels\, fulfilling their mission to engage\, enrich\, and inspire people through the power of film. We celebrate the art of cinema and provide impactful educational experiences for our local\, national and global communities. \nSBIFF continues its commitment to education and the community through our many free educational programs and events. In June 2016\, SBIFF entered a new era with the acquisition of the historic and beloved Riviera Theatre. After a capital campaign and renovation\, the theatre is now SBIFF’s new state-of-the-art\, year-round home\, showing new international and independent films every day.
